Output ed9139d23eb9281b60b1eeceed6df758fb1ef5cd6b2228275282aa567f635e32:0

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f5aa8f37b8fef946fc4f13734aa6a47030c9d8b OP_EQUAL
address
3Em1A96J1V5iKbhWAttgjCofhybEhz88Kv
transaction
ed9139d23eb9281b60b1eeceed6df758fb1ef5cd6b2228275282aa567f635e32
confirmations
358709
spent
true